Part 1: Why 3PL Software Matters More Than Ever
The pace of business gets faster every year. Because of this, companies need strong tools that help them respond quickly. Third‑party logistics software gives teams the visibility and control they need to keep operations moving. Even small improvements can create big gains.
To begin with, 3PL software creates one central place for all shipping, warehousing, and tracking details. Teams no longer need to jump between tools. They get one clear dashboard instead. Decisions become easier and faster. This simple level of structure also reduces errors. As a result, it lowers costs in daily operations.
Another important factor is customer expectation. Today’s buyers want fast shipping and real‑time updates. Professional 3PL software lets companies share accurate details without delay. Updates happen automatically. This saves time for every team. It also keeps customers informed. That steady flow of updated information builds trust and encourages repeat business.
Part 2: Features That Make It Truly Spectacular
Many tools claim to support logistics. Still, only great 3PL software brings all tasks together in a smooth and friendly way. Several features stand out and make a real difference in daily work.
Real‑time tracking is one of the most valuable features. Users can see where shipments are at any moment. This clear view reduces confusion. It also helps teams solve problems before they grow. Managers get a better picture of carrier performance over time.
Automated workflows create another strong benefit. The software removes repetitive tasks and frees teams to focus on higher‑value work. Tasks like order creation, label printing, and status updates can run on their own. This improves accuracy. It also saves hours each week.
Easy integrations also matter. Smooth connections with e‑commerce platforms, accounting systems, and warehouse tools keep everything working together. Companies avoid double-entry. They also cut down on mistakes. Teams gain a full picture of the business without extra effort.
Finally, scalability helps the software grow with the company. The system adapts whether a business ships ten orders or ten thousand. Because of this, companies can expand without fear of outgrowing their tools.
Part 3: How to Choose the Best for Your Needs
With so many options available, choosing the right 3PL software may seem difficult. Still, a few simple steps can make the choice clearer. First, review your daily tasks. Look for a solution that removes manual work and makes those tasks easier. If a feature feels confusing or slow, it may not be the right fit.
Next, look at the user experience. A clean layout helps teams learn faster. It also keeps them productive. Smooth navigation lowers training costs. A simple and intuitive design prevents frustration. It also encourages consistent use.
You should also think about customer support. As your business grows, new questions will appear. Responsive support helps the software stay valuable over time. A strong support team acts like a partner, not just a vendor.
Lastly, plan for the future. Choose a system that can grow with you. It should add features, connect with new tools, and handle more volume as business needs change. This smart planning helps you avoid costly upgrades or major transitions later.
